Hi >At 04:56 PM 12/12/00 +0000, Edd Dumbill wrote: >>This discussion puts me in mind of a couple of questions I've had for a >>while on this. Here are some things I'd like to say about the target >>resource to be embedded: >> >> * style it with this XSLT/CSS sheet >> * confirm its signature matches this one <<insert-sig-here>> >> >>Are there any standard ways of expressing this kind of thing yet? If >>not, do we need one? In fact, links and inclusion are strange beast. We have experimented a lot with the Xinclude and the xlink constructs and found certain limitations like: caching: it is very rare that document providers set the caching property in the right manner. It is a lot useful to be able to override a cache document's time to live. styling: If a document contains more than one fragment to include, to be able to process each fragment before any inclusion can accelerate the overall processing if we can perform the transformations and the inclusions in parallel. device-profiling: to be able to include XML fragments for certain kind of devices but not for others - kind of conditional inclusion user-profiling: to be able to include XML fragments for certain users and not for others - an other kind of conditional inclusion to override or include certain attributes: if an included fragment is to be referred by other parts of the document then it is useful that, for instance, the id attribute can be overridden so that the links work. The id that this root element contains may not be the right one. These are the few we discovered and I am sure they are other limitations. cheers Didier PH Martin ---------------------------------------------- Email: martind@n...
